Job Summary

Heartland Retail is looking for a Senior Full Stack Developer to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for the sophisticated design and consistent performance of our applications.

You will work to maintain current functionality while also ensuring that we continually ship new features that achieve high utilization and user satisfaction.

You will be working alongside other engineers and developers on different layers of the infrastructure. Therefore, a commitment to collaborative problem solving, sophisticated design, and the creation of quality products is essential.

You are excited by the challenge of rapidly delivering improvements to delight our customers and help their businesses thrive while at the same time maintaining the rock-solid stability required by a mission-critical system.

Heartland Retail is a fully distributed team so this is a remote position but will potentially have an option for an in-office setting flexibility pending your location.

All of our processes are designed with a remote-first mindset.

Your skills will be needed in developing and maintaining our commercial products to grow profitability and market share. Including but not limited to : optimizing deployment pipelines;

automating manual and repetitive activities; researching new technology; providing proof-of-concept demonstrations and much more.

Teamwork is an important part of Heartland's success and you will be expected to mentor and develop your teammates and to work effectively with many different functional roles in our organization from operations, to infrastructure, to quality assurance and beyond.

Duties

Design and build applications for web platforms using Ruby and Javascript / TypeScript

Ensure the performance and quality of applications

Collaborate with a team to define, design, and ship new features

Identify and correct bottlenecks and fix bugs

Help maintain code quality, organization, and automation

Support the diagnosis of customer issues and resolution

Review your teammates' Pull Requests and provide helpful feedback

Write and perform unit and integration tests

Become a Heartland Retail product expert

Job Requirements

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, related field or equivalent experience.

5+ years experience developing web applications

Proficiency with Ruby

Proficiency with RESTful API design and / or GraphQL

Proficiency with JavaScript or Typescript and modern front-end client libraries (e.g. React)

Sound SQL and relational databases knowledge

Experience working with AWS services.

Solid knowledge of testing principles

Experience with Git

Strong written and verbal communication skills
